Wind Surf Club 8th Annual O'Neill Capitola Women's Longboard Surf Fest Saturday October 11, 2003 Where:
Capitola Peak, Main Beach Capitola No
Cash Prizes Sponsored by; O'Neill and K-Pig Radio For more information call the Hotline# (831) 464-5080 Below are the contest rules. For a entry form click here
These rules are intended to put the focus on a surfers skill,control,and style, while riding a wave. The rules are also deigned to encourage wave judgment. The rules are intended to return the focus of surfing to fun and quality not aggression and quantity. The rules are: 1. A surfer is eligible to ride a maximum of five waves. The ride begins when the surfer's hands leave the rail of the surfboard. Surfers will be scored on their best three waves. 2. Rides are scored on a scale of 0-10. Scores would reflect the length of ride, skill, and style. The following maneuvers are score able: turns, cutbacks, board trim, coasters, floaters, sideslips, stalls, tube rides, soup/whitewater control. Unscoreable tricks include: spinners coffins, head stands, etc. 3. Right-of-way on the Wave: if two contestants stand up at the same time, the person farthest back has possession of the wave. If the surfer takes off behind a person already standing, they will be declared a "drop-in" and the ride will be scored a "0" and be counted. Splitting peaks is OK as long as one goes left and one goes right. 4. Surfing Interference: If you are called for interference, you will receive a "0" and that wave will be one of your scoring waves. If you feel you have interfered, or have been interfered with, listen for a call from the P.A.. If you have been interfered with, you will be allowed an additional wave. 5. Leashes are optional. 6. Surfers are to exit the water upon completion of their five waves or when your heat is over. Wave count is your responsibility. 7. If a contestant drops into a wave before their heat starts or after their heat ends, the wave counts has one of three waves and scored as a "0". Contest Director will resolve wave disputes. 8. Sportsmanship: All participants in the contests must adhere to good sportsmanship throughout the event. Any individual who argues with a judge's decision, uses profanity, fights, is overly aggressive to the point where judges think that it is not in the best interest of the conflict, that individual will be disqualified. THIS WILL BE STRICTLY ENFORCED. Novice Eligibility: The Novice Division is a way for newcomers to participate in Surf Fest. We strive to have an event where the competition is part of the fun and not the primary reason to participate. No one may surf more than 2 years in the Novice Division of this contest. If you have the ability to walk the nose, do drop-knee turns, multiple cutbacks, or if your abilities are greater than turning and trimming your board, you are not a novice. If the judges do not believe you belong in the Novice Division, they will not give you a score. HAVE
